Isles of Scilly Steamship Company
www.islesofscilly-travel.co.ukFly with Isles of Scilly Travel from Exeter, Newquay and Land’s End Airports and enjoy breath-taking aerial views of this beautiful cluster of islands from the comfort of your Skybus plane.
Flights from Land’s End take just 15 minutes or half an hour from Newquay, and operate all year round from Monday to Saturday. There are scheduled flights from Exeter Airport between March and October six days a week which reach Scilly in under an hour.
Island Helicopters start from May with up to eight flights available from Land’s End Airport to St Mary’s, six days a week. From spring through to late autumn, the Scillonian lll passenger ferry sails up to seven days a week between Penzance and St. Mary’s. To book your journey, phone 01736 334220 or visit the website

South West Coast Path Association
www.southwestcoastpath.org.ukFor almost half a century, the South West Coast Path Association has been helping to protect, care for and champion the South West Coast Path as one of the world’s greatest trails and one of the region’s most important environmental and tourism assets. The Path now attracts over 9 million visitors a year and brings over £520 million into the local tourism economy.
As a charity, our mission is to help people access, enjoy and share in the amazing health-giving benefits and spectacular wildlife which our 630 mile National Trail offers. We work with businesses along the Path (Way Makers), volunteers and members to raise funds to improve and care for the Trail – a task which is becoming increasingly important in light of current climate change.

Adventures by Bus
www.adventuresbybus.co.ukAdventures by Bus is the new and exciting brand for sightseeing services in First South West. It heads and incorporates an exciting ‘family of adventures; Atlantic Coaster, Falmouth Coaster, Land’s End Coaster, Day Tripper, The Lizard, Dartmoor Explorer, Discover Exeter and the Exmoor Coaster.
Each of the individual adventures has their own characteristics which represent the unique nature of the routes – their landscape, geography and the different customers that they attract. Some are open top such as our Land’s End, Atlantic, Falmouth and Exmoor Coaster, to enable adventurers to absorb the stunning scenery. Others are more informative, like our Discover Exeter city tour, complete with audio whilst our Cornwall DayTripper network simply connects a variety of attractions and pretty places across mid-Cornwall, with the Eden Project as its hub.

Access Cornwall
accesscornwall.org.ukAccess Cornwall is an online guide with detailed accessibility information about venues and organisations around Cornwall which actively welcome those who have challenges such as vision, hearing or mobility impairment, learning issues or autism. This valuable resource is built with input from people who live with disabilities and long-term health conditions. Access Cornwall provides essential information to those planning enjoyable activities with friends and families, and the organisation also supports and promotes Cornish businesses who want to become more accessible.
